Re: Appraisals
Yes, a real estate agent will do a complimentary market analysis. It's common... I frequently do home valuations for people who don't have intention of putting their house on the market (e.g. for probate court, divorce, etc.)
An appraisal will cost a few hundred dollars.
There is no website that will be able to provide the right data. It's not just about finding comps, i.e. other sales in the area. It's about selecting the right comps, and being able to interpret them. Real estate agents have access to far greater and more accurate info than any consumer real estate site can provide.
